It's going to be difficult; (if not impossible). First contact Redman at the related link to see if they still have schematics dating back that far.

Ultimately, you may have to make your own schematic. I have inspected literally thousands of mobile homes in the production phase, for dozens of manufacturers. The method I use to see what is on a particular circuit, is to turn off all of the circuit breakers, except one, and using a polarity checker (or by switching on various lights) identify which outlets are still on; thereby identifying which circuit its on.

For guidance, lights are normally on 15 amp, and there are normally 2-4 lighting circuits in a home. (Lighting circuits are any circuit which is not a small appliance, laundry or special circuit). Living rooms, bedrooms and utility rooms will normally be on a 15 amp circuit.

There will two (or more), 20 amp circuits run to the kitchen recepts. The recepts over the countertops are required to be on a minimum of two different circuits. The dinning room can be run off of one of the kitchen circuits, or it can be on it's own 20 amp circuit. Back in 91 the family room would have been on a 20 amp circuit from the kitchen.

Bathrooms require a GFCI protected outlet, and it usually is continued out to protect the exterior outlet.

Laundry area recept will be 20 amp, which will serve the washer and a gas dryer (electric dryer is on a separate circuit at 240 volt, 30 amp).

Of course the 240 volts circuits are obvious to their use, water heaters are normally 25 amp (possibly 30 but that would be oversizing), dryer- 30 amp, electric furnace- 70-90 amp, a/c- 30- 50 amp, etc. Circuit breakers which have two handles tied together are 240 volt appliances).

Determining "how" the wires are run, from which recept to the next, is much more difficult, especially after the home is built. A few basic rules are 'usually' followed.

Usually, a circuit runs to the closest outlet and to each in succession using the shortest run of wire. All recepts on exterior walls will run in dado's on the wall, interior cables may either drop from the ceiling, come up from below floor or run in dado's in the walls. Most commonly, a circuit is run on the exterior wall, and feeds recepts in the same room by continuing into the interior walls (from the sidewall).

If you are thinking of adding an outlet to an existing circuit, be very careful that you fully understand exactly what you are doing. I strongly recommend you get a building permit at your local building department and follow any instructions he may give.

Remember this, if you are work causes a fire, (even after you sell the home and move on), you will be held libel for the total loss. And, your insurance company may not be willing to pay based on the fact you did this without a permit (AKA it's against the law ever where in the US).

If you are having a problem in the wiring, isolating the various outlets will tell you if any are not working, and possibly lead you to conclude where the fault may lie. Just remember that the circuit starts at the panelbox and usually through up the outside wall.
